thanks guys,its an Auto Spring 2" level with rear AAL. thats funny you mentioned traction control because it has came on three times while going about 25mph and turning a curve.this is the first i have read anything on this so i did a search and found alot of info.cant believe all the leveled truck posts ive read and never heard of this. also i have not rubbed anywhere one time yet. tires actually look better in person than in pics.
